ABOUT Indian Nougat RECIPE

Nougat is an Italian recipe .Here it is been twisted with Indian taste of adding Cardamom, rose water and rose petals with the regular nougat recipe.

Ingredients Serving: 10

  1. Honey 3 / 4 cup
  2. Sugar 1/2 cup
  3. Egg white 1
  4. Salt a pinch
  5. cardamom 4 number with 1 1/2 teaspoon sugar .
  6. Rosewater 2 teaspoon
  7. Lemon Zest 1 tbsp
  8. roasted Almonds 1/2 cup
  9. Roasted Pistachios 1/2 cup
  10. Raisins 1/2 Cup
  11. Dried rose petals 1 fistful

Instructions

  1. Line a square tin with parchment paper
  2. Roast Almond and Pistachio until crisp.
  3. Keep the roasted Almonds and pistachios in a warm place until ready to add at the end. This makes it easier to mix them in.
  4. Pour honey ,sugar with cardamom powder in a heavy bottom pan and mix well till it forms silky smooth syrup.
  5. It takes nearly 20 minutes to achieve this consistency. Switch off the flame and keep it aside.
  6. whisk egg white with a Pinch of salt till like a shaving foam texture.
  7. Place the pan on gas top and keep on low heat
  8. Gradually add whipped egg whites little by little to the sugar and honey mixture and mix thoroughly.
  9. Continue cooking the mixture over low heat ,stirring constantly with a spatula until the mixture forms Ribbon consistency and the pattern remains for few seconds.
  10. This will take 20 to 25 minutes to achieve this consistency.Add Rose water and mix thoroughly.
  11. Add rose petals , lemon zest, roasted nuts and raisins and stir to incorporate evenly.
  12. Transfer the mixture to the prepared tin and spread evenly with the help of spatula.
  13. Place a parchment paper on top and gently press the mixture down with the help of Katori.
  14. Allow them to sit at room temperature until cool,firm and ready to cut.
  15. Cut using a serrated knife and wrap it up with the parchment paper and store in an airtight container.
  16. Fusion Indian Nougat with cardamom and rose water flavour is ready to consume.
